# Tcl 调用 Python 函数的实现方法
作为一名开发者,能将多种编程语言结合使用是一项非常有用的技能。本文将指导你如何在 Tcl 脚本中调用 Python 函数。以下是整个流程的概述。
## 流程概览
| 步骤 | 描述 |
|-----------------|---------------
# Python调用Tcl函数的实现流程
在Python中调用Tcl函数,我们需要使用`tkinter`库的`Tcl`模块。下面是整个实现的流程:
| 步骤 | 说明 |
| --- | --- |
| 步骤1 | 导入`tkinter`库的`Tcl`模块 |
| 步骤2 | 创建Tcl解释器对象 |
| 步骤3 | 在Tcl解释器对象中注册Tcl函数 |
| 步骤4 | 调用Tcl函数 |
原创
2023-12-04 15:54:12
115阅读
本文内容采用知识共享署名-非商业性使用-相同方式共享 4.0 许可协议。Python语言可以用在很多方面,网站开发、数据分析、运营维护、游戏开发等等,那么桌面应用程序GUI呢?其实Python标准库里自带Tkinter就是干这个的。相比PyQT、wxPython等等,Tkinter有哪些优势和不足,是否值得学呢?Tkinter是什么?要了解Tkinter,首先要从Tcl编程语言说起。
转载
2023-11-22 22:57:57
148阅读
今天遇到一个问题,一个设备的接口API都是tcl脚本形式的,但是我的code都是python的,然后python需要调用tcl。以下是简单的解决方法。
先写一个tcl脚本(求阶乘)helloworld.tcl:
#!usr/bin/tclsh
proc Factorial {n} {
if {$n<=1} {
&
原创
2012-02-22 16:45:11
10000+阅读
点赞
1评论
Tkinter————Python默认的图形界面接口。Tkinter是一个和Tk接口的模块,Tkinter库提供了对Tk API的接口,它属于Tcl/Tk的GUI工具组。Tcl/Tk是由John Ousterhout发展的书写和图形设备。Tcl(工具命令语言)是个宏语言,用于简化shell下复杂程序的开发,Tk工具包是和Tcl一起开发的,目的是为了简化用户接口的设计过程。Tk工具包由许多不同的小部
转载
2023-10-29 06:22:36
179阅读
# TCL 调用 Python 的探索
在现代编程中,Python 和 TCL (Tool Command Language) 是两种流行的脚本语言。Python 以其丰富的库和强大的功能受到开发者的青睐,而 TCL 则因其在嵌入式系统和 GUI 开发中的便利性而广泛使用。本文将探讨如何在 TCL 环境中调用 Python 代码,并提供具体的代码示例。
## 为什么要在 TCL 中调用 Pyt
【简单介绍|特性】l 简单介绍Tcl是一门产生于80年代末的语言,和Python一样,她是用c开发出来的。假设说C/Java/C++/C#为编译型语言的话,那么Python、Perl和Tcl就是一门解释性语言。也就是说程序不须要先编译为机器能识别的二进制码,再执行程序。而是直接能够执行。其技术实现主要借助于Tcl中的库作为解析器。假设你知道Python的话,其执行步骤例如以下:pyth
转载
2024-02-20 09:51:49
152阅读
python3.6(python-gcc:7.3)-anaconda-写c扩展-undefined symbol:找错误关于opencv的转换https://github.com/Algomorph/pyboostcvconverter/blob/master/src/pyboost_cv3_converter.cpp上次的博客比较乱,这次尽量不乱。。。。。。扩展库,首先保证cpp库的链接正确,u
转载
2024-07-24 08:29:14
50阅读
python:tkinter —— Tcl/Tk 的 Python 接口架构Tkinter 模块Tkinter 拾遗Hello World 程序重要的 Tk 概念了解 Tkinter 如何封装 Tcl/Tk我该如何...?这个选项会做...?浏览 Tcl/Tk 参考手册线程模型快速参考可选配置项包装器包装器的参数部件与变量的关联窗口管理器Tk 参数的数据类型绑定和事件index 参数图片文件处理
转载
2023-11-09 14:27:09
234阅读
array_shift() 函数删除数组中第一个元素,并返回被删除元素的值。 注释:如果键名是数字的,所有元素都会获得新的键名,从 0 开始,并以 1 递增(参见下面例子)。从数组中取到lid,做匹配tc日志用处 is_numeric() 如果指定的变量是数字和数字字符串则返回 TRUE,否则返回 FALSE。 exec()外部执行函数 implode() 函数返回由数组元素组合成的字符串。 fi
需求分析公司要求做自动化测试,在交换芯片流片前测试芯片的功能,在palladium上跑综合网表,仿真实现芯片的功能,具体如何实现的就不细说了,不是重点TAT。我目前的工作就是负责能够用脚本SSH远程服务器,执行Linux下执行一些之前写好的测试程序(芯片的配置代码),同时在配置好芯片后,使用脚本控制测试仪,使得测试仪构造报文,发流停流等功能。由于我们租用的思博伦测试仪版本太老,只支持TCL脚本控制
转载
2024-05-15 03:37:25
326阅读
# Python 调用 TCL 脚本的完整指南
在现代软件开发中,有时我们需要连接不同的编程语言以利用其各自的优势。在这篇文章中,我们将重点介绍如何使用 Python 调用 TCL 脚本。我们将分步进行,并确保你能理解每个步骤。
## 整体流程
在开始之前,我们来概述一下整个过程的步骤。以下是实现 Python 调用 TCL 脚本的流程:
| 步骤 | 描述 |
|------|-----
我正在写一个脚本来提取一些关于我一直在运行的一系列化学模拟的有用数据。为了得到这些数据,我需要(1)一个C程序,它从一个名为*.pdb的文件类型计算密度。我已经有了。(2)我需要使用一个名为vmd的程序来获得pdb。为了从命令行完成(2),我可以提交一个tcl脚本,因为vmd有一个内置的tcl解释器。这些函数——调用vmd运行tcl脚本,然后运行编译后的c程序——将是我的包装器数据提取脚本的关键活
转载
2023-12-30 15:15:52
67阅读
# TCL调用Python方法的应用研究
随着科技的发展,编程语言的多样性为软件开发带来了极大的灵活性。在众多编程语言中,TCL(Tool Command Language)和Python都因其易用性和强大的功能而受到广泛欢迎。本文将探讨如何在TCL中调用Python方法,并通过代码示例让读者深入理解这一过程。
## TCL简介
TCL是一种高层次的、解释型的脚本语言,广泛用于快速开发和测试
# 使用Python调用Tcl文件的完整指南
在软件开发过程中,有时我们需要利用不同语言编写的代码来完成特定的功能。比如,您可能需要通过Python调用用Tcl编写的脚本。本文将为您详细介绍如何实现这一目标,包括流程步骤和代码示例。
## 流程步骤
在调用Tcl文件之前,我们首先需要了解整个过程。您可以参考以下表格,了解实现的每个步骤及其简介。
| 步骤 | 描述 |
|------|--
# 如何实现 TCL 调用 Python 脚本
在现代软件开发中,许多程序员可能会面临需要在不同语言之间进行交互的情况。本文将向你展示如何通过 TCL 调用 Python 脚本。这一过程分为几个步骤,并通过具体代码和注释来详细说明每一步的实现流程。
## 整体流程
我们首先来看看整个过程的步骤:
| 步骤 | 描述 |
|
# Python调用Tcl函数
## 引言
Python是一种简单易学且功能强大的编程语言,广泛应用于各个领域。而Tcl(Tool Command Language)是一种脚本语言,主要用于快速开发GUI界面和自动化工具。在某些情况下,我们可能需要在Python中调用Tcl函数来实现一些特定的功能。本文将介绍如何使用Python调用Tcl函数,并给出详细的代码示例。
## Tcl函数的基本概
原创
2024-01-02 05:39:03
112阅读
如果命令没有相互依赖的状态,则可以将它们并行化.有很多方法可以做到这一点,但其中一个更容易的是使用线程包的thread pooling(这需要一个线程Tcl,现在许多平台上的标准):package require Thread
set pool [tpool::create -maxworkers 4]
# The list of *scripts* to evaluate
set tasks {
转载
2024-05-21 22:41:20
142阅读
阅读前言文章索引21之前,都采用0xA0这种方式分类,现在直接使用名字,可能会好一点,毕竟有些不习惯。本公众号目前已涉及内容:1)Qt2)STM323)硬件4)C语言5)python1、了解TkinterTkinter是Python基于Tk工具包的默认GUI库。Tk工具包最初是为Tcl(工具命令语言)设计的,Tk普及后,其被移植到很多的其他脚本语言。2、使用方法在文件中直接导入Tkinter模块即
转载
2023-10-08 14:38:20
95阅读
# Python调用Tcl并传递参数指南
在这个快速变化的技术世界中,Python和Tcl都是非常重要的编程语言。虽然可能大多数人对这两种语言相对独立,但在某些情况下,结合使用这两种语言会大大增强应用的能力。本文将指导你如何在Python中调用Tcl并传递参数。
## 整体流程
在开始之前,我们先来梳理整件事情的流程。下表展示了Python调用Tcl并传参的步骤。
| 步骤 | 描述